반응형
이스케이프문자 종류
파이선에서 백 슬래시(\)와 조합해서 사용하는 문자이다. 이스케이프 문자에 따라 기능이 각각 다르다.
아래 표를 참고하여 사용가능하다.
이스케이프 문자 | 설명 |
\n | 줄 바꿈 |
\t | 탭 |
\b | 백스페이스 |
\000 | 널문자 |
\\ | \ |
\' | 작은따옴표 |
\" | 큰따옴표 |
\r | 줄 바꿈, 커서를 앞으로 이동 |
\f | 줄 바꿈, 커서를 다음 줄로 이동 |
\a | 벨소리 |
\v | 수직 탭 |
사용 예시는 다음과 같다.
print("Hello world") ### 기본 Hello world print("Hello\nworld") ### \n 줄바꿈 Hello world print("Hello\tworld") ### \t 탭 Hello world print("H\bello world") ### \b 백스페이스 ello world print("\000") # \000 널문자 print("\\Hello world\\") ### \\ '\' \Hello world\ print("\"Hello world\"") ### 큰따옴표 "Hello world" print('Hello world') ###사용안하면 그냥 출력 나옴 Hello world print('\'Hello world\'') ### 작은 따옴표 'Hello world' |
그 밖에 정규 표현식에 대해서는 아래 참고 포스팅을 참고하면 도움 될것이다.
참고 포스팅
https://thenicesj.tistory.com/334
반응형
'IT > Python' 카테고리의 다른 글
matplotlib.pyplot 사용법 (49) | 2023.07.19 |
---|---|
파이선에서 날짜 문자열 추출 (31) | 2023.06.13 |
글읽기, 수정하기 (read, readline, readlines) (15) | 2023.02.28 |
파이선 함수 선언 (15) | 2023.01.17 |
파이선에서 파일 읽고 쓰기 (9) | 2023.01.16 |
댓글